Advancements in Computer Vision: Techniques, Applications, and Future Directions

Abstract

Computer Vision is a transformative field of artificial intelligence that enables machines to understand and interpret visual information from the real world. This paper explores the fundamental techniques used in image and video recognition, object detection, and scene understanding. It delves into the algorithms and deep learning architectures that power these systems and highlights their practical applications in sectors such as autonomous vehicles and medical imaging. Through a comprehensive analysis of current methodologies, challenges, and emerging trends, the paper aims to present a clear understanding of the trajectory of computer vision and its impact on technological innovation.
